The second Business Forum in Batumi organized by IBCCS Georgia with the support of the Government of Autonomous Republic of Adjara
Benefits of doing business in Georgia and reliable investment opportunities will be introduced within the intentional business and professional community.
The event is addressed to professionals, entrepreneurs, investors, business executives and individuals having an interest in exploring tax, legal, business and investment incentives of Georgia.
The previous events were successfully held in Georgia, Poland, Estonia and Cyprus attracting more than a few hundred business people from all over the world.
